Stoke Golding is a compact village in the borough of Hinckley and Bosworth, in rural Leicestershire, England, a few miles south‑west of Market Bosworth and close to Hinckley. It has a classic village feel with a green, timber‑framed and brick cottages and a medieval church at its heart, giving a strong sense of historic continuity.
The village is often linked with the nearby Battle of Bosworth (1485) and the wider Tudor story, and today combines agriculture with a commuter population working in towns such as Leicester. There’s an active community life - pub, village hall, school and regular events - and a quiet, largely residential economy shaped by local farming and small businesses.
